Interacting with Docker containers

Linux container technologies, especially Docker, have grown in popularity in recent years, and this has continued since the previous edition of this book was published. Containers provide a fast path to resource isolation while maintaining the consistency of the runtime environment. They can be launched quickly and are efficient to run, as there is very little overhead involved. Utilities such as Docker provide a lot of useful tooling for container management, such as a registry of images to use as the filesystem, tooling to build the images themselves, clustering orchestration, and so on. Through its ease of use, Docker has become one of the most popular ways to manage containers, though others, such as Podman and LXC, are becoming much more prevalent. For now, though, we will focus on Docker, given its broad appeal and wide install base.
